Latest Patents
One of Hilton's latest patents is focused on wafer probing that conditions devices for flip-chip bonding. This innovative probing system not only tests electrical devices fabricated on a wafer but also conditions terminals, such as solder balls, to improve the uniformity of their heights. This enhancement leads to more reliable connections to interconnect substrates in flip-chip packages or printed circuit boards in chip-on-board applications. The system utilizes a probe card that can be a printed circuit board, allowing for quick changes to reduce automated test equipment (ATE) downtime and accommodate device changes like die shrink. The probe tips on the probe card serve as the normal electrical contact structures of the interconnect substrates.
Another significant patent by Hilton is the flip-chip package with an underfill dam for stress control. This innovation introduces a dam or barrier around the periphery of a die in a flip-chip package, which alters the shape of the underfill to minimize stress caused by edge effects. The dam includes a treated region of a substrate that attracts the underfill material, controlling its wetting angle and shaping it to eliminate stress sources. This design also helps avoid areas with differing thermal coefficients of expansion, ensuring optimal performance.
